Steve says he is unlikely to do anything before Thursday's deadline

Steve Davis admits that it is unlikely that he will bring in any more loan signings before Thursday’s deadline, but he has indicated that he will do business in January if he feels he can improve his side. The Alex boss is certainly after another midfield player on a permanent basis during the transfer window to offer cover and competition for his only two senior players in a central role Luke Murphy and Abdul Osman.

Steve told crewealex.net: “We've got Max (Clayton) back now and we are expecting AJ (Leitch-Smith) and Westy (Michael West) back soon as well.

 

“We have to get what we can out of the players we have got, move them around and try to find the winning combination. I've got to stick with them. 

 

“Of course, they have until January to prove that they can do it on a consistent basis. They have shown that they can in glimpses and done well in some games and then had blanks in others. They have a bit of breathing space to prove they can become more clinical and when I mean that I mean the front six.

 

“We need our forward players to threaten the goal more and take those chances. That is what we have done this week, working on our crossing and shooting and hopefully if something drops at Sheffield United we will be in a better frame of mind to take those chances.”
